Students have lots of options to chooose from today when trying to decide which college to attend. College Factual has developed its “Best Value Women’s Studies Schools in the Far Western US Region” ranking as one item you can use to help make this decision.

In 2020-2021, 2,868 people earned their degree in women’s studies, making the major the 259th most popular in the United States.

Across the Far Western US region, there were 669 women’s studies gra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ively.

This year’s “Best Value Women’s Studies Schools in the Far Western US Region” ranking looked at 14 colleges that offer degrees in a bachelor’s in women’s studies. The schools that top this list are recognized because they have great women’s studies programs and cost less that schools of similar quality.

When determining these rankings, we looked at things such as overall quality of the women’s studies program at the school and the cost to attend the school once aid has been awarded. For more information, check out our ranking methodology.

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end California State University - Long Beach. The school came in at #1 for the Best Value Women’s Studies Schools in the Far Western US Region. CSULB is a large public school situated in Long Beach, California. It awarded 17 ’s women’s studies degrees in 2020-2021.

CSULB also took the #6 spot in our “Best Women’s Studies Schools in the Far Western US Region” ranking. The estimated yearly cost for California State University - Long Beach is $10,054 for Far Western US Region Women’s Studies students.

The low undergrad student loan default rate of 2.4% is a good sign that students have an easier time paying off their loans than they might at other schools. For comparison, the national default rate is 10.1%. Students who start out at the school are likely to stick around. The freshman retention rate is 89%.

San Diego State University
San Diego, California

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end San Diego State University. It ranked #2 on our 2023 Best Value Women’s Studies Schools in the Far Western US Region list. SDSU is a public institution located in San Diego, California. The school has a large population, and it awarded 27 ’s degrees in 2020-2021.

In addition to being on our far western us region women’s studies students list, SDSU has also earned the #4 rank in our “Best Women’s Studies Schools in the Far Western US Region” ranking. It costs about $13,845 for far western us region women’s studies students per year to attend San Diego State University.

The school has an impressive undergrad student loan default rate. It’s only 2.2%, which is much lower than the national rate of 10.1%. With a freshman retention rate of 89%, the school does an excellent job of retaining its undergraduate students.
